How it feels

This film follows a group of young people in a Chinese military arts troupe during the 1970s and 1980s. Their friendships and romances unfold against the backdrop of cultural change and political turmoil.

What happens

Youth (Chinese: 芳华) is a 2017 Chinese period drama film directed by Feng Xiaogang and written by Geling Yan. The film is based on Yan's semi-autobiographical story You Touched Me. It was screened in the Special Presentations section at the 2017 Toronto International Film Festival. It was scheduled to be released in China on October 1, 2017, but after previews in Beijing and other cities was pulled from the National Day schedule. It was released on 15 December 2017. Youth grossed over $235 million worldwide, becoming the sixth highest-grossing Chinese film of 2017.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
